Job description

Overview

We look for computational materials scientists excited about bridging the gap between materials/chemistry, data science, and computer science to help us develop a software framework for designing and discovering new advanced materials and chemicals.

Work will focus on (1) the application of nanoscale modeling to large sets of materials, surfaces, and reaction pathways with minimal human input, (2) organizing the data produced by the models and experimental validation, (3) establishing artificial intelligence approaches using the data.

Successful candidates will continue into leadership roles as we grow. This is a full-time permanent position.

Minimum Requirements

Scientific

  • Excellent knowledge of chemistry/materials science (Ph.D. from a tier-1 lab)
  • Prior work on advanced electronic structure methods (VASP, Quantum ESPRESSO, Gaussian, NWChem, Siesta, or similar)
  • Prior experience with machine learning

Engineering

  • Python (advanced)
  • Linux/RedHat/Bash (advanced)
  • MongoDB/JSON (intermediate)
  • Message-passing interface / OpenMP (intermediate)
  • Other (GPU, TPU) - willing to learn

Other

  • Ability to learn and apply new concepts rapidly
  • Extreme attention to details

Plus

  • Familiarity with AWS EC2, Microsoft Azure
  • Familiarity with SaltStack or similar
